Think • Plan • Act – Choosing the Right Security Equipment for Your Event

Jun 9, 2026 | Security Equipment Guides

Planning an event involves more than organising entertainment, food and logistics.

Whether you’re hosting a festival, sporting event, corporate function, government-sanctioned activity or community gathering, security should never be an afterthought.

The good news?

Choosing the right security setup doesn’t have to be complicated.

A simple approach is to follow three steps:

✅ THINK

A security guard uses a handheld scanner on a man passing through a metal detector; a woman waits her turn nearby. People and event signage are visible in the background.

Understand the Risks Before the Event Starts

Before choosing any security equipment, ask yourself:

✔ How many people are attending?
✔ Is it a public or private event?
✔ Will alcohol be involved?
✔ Are bags being brought into the venue?
✔ Is there a VIP or high-risk area?
✔ Could prohibited items become a concern?

Not every event requires the same level of security.

A local school fete has very different needs compared with a large music festival or public event.

Thinking ahead helps organisers avoid last-minute problems.

Because the reality is:

Good event security starts with good planning.

✅ PLAN

A person holds a handheld metal detector over an open black and gray bag, inspecting its contents on a flat surface.

Choose the Right Security Equipment

Once risks are identified, it becomes easier to choose the right setup.

✔ Walkthrough Metal Detectors – Ideal for festivals, sporting events, concerts and large public gatherings.

✔ Handheld Metal Detector Wands – Perfect for secondary screening, VIP areas and additional checks.

✔ X-Ray Machines – Best for bag screening, high-security events, corporate functions and government activities.

✔ Visible Security Measures – Improve attendee confidence and discourage prohibited items.

In many situations:
Deterrence can be more effective than detection.

✅ ACT

A slide titled Venue Assessment with two bullet points about event analysis and incident planning. On the right, there is an illustration of a security guard in uniform with a hat and mustache.

Create a Safer, More Professional Event

Once your security plan is in place:

✔ Brief your staff
✔ Clearly manage entry points
✔ Position equipment effectively
✔ Communicate expectations to attendees

At its best, event security creates confidence for attendees, staff, organisers and local authorities.
